It's been a few years since I have had to go out and do a job search but that may change in the not so distant future. I have been doing a bit of reading on some tips to job searching and there seem to be a few recurring themes or tips out there.
1. Google yourself and see if anything negative comes up. You can sure bet that most employers will be doing the same. If you have negative related material about you on the internet you might want to start looking into getting it removed. Posting dirty jokes on a chat board isn't going to help your case.
2. Get a professional email address or use the one that came with your ISP. Chunky lover at aol dot com just isn't going to sell anybody. It's funny on the Simpsons but that's a cartoon.
3. If you are interested in a certain field or profession find clubs or organizations related to those and join them or attend seminars and meetings. It's a great way to network, pick up tips on upcoming jobs and learn about educational requirements or changes.
4. Join more than one job search website. Why limit yourself to just one? You might find something interesting on another site. Make sure you sign up for alerts and notifications for new job postings.
5. Make sure you have your resume updated and ready to go. Having to put a resume together at the last minute is counter productive.
The biggest thing to remember is not to give up hope. Nothing is going to come fast. You have to be patient and dig at it.

A couple we hang out are about to have their second child over the next couple of weeks. We were talking about the cost of having another baby in the house. There are so many things to consider and so many ways to cut down on the cost of having a new baby. I am going to look into finding some articles and suggestions more in depth.
The first thing we were talking about was baby announcements. It doesn't seem like much but if you have a big family the postage and mailing can add up. I suggested finding a free webspace page like wordpress, myspace, facebook and making up a birth announcement page complete with information, pictures and comments for your friends and family to fill out. You can always email the link to your friends and family.
If you want, get the traditional mail outs and send them to your immediate family. You can always email everyone else and save a few bucks.
